    Nice romantic walk. Actually, Jardines de Murillo's would be part of the must see icon places/monuments in Seville. I would say start at Plaza de España then walk across Prado de San Sebastian to reach Jardines de Murillo, walk by its massive and iconic fountain and then continue your walk through La Juderia's streets (the ancient Jewish quarter) taking and enjoying your time to admire Santa Cruz Sq, Agua Street, Vida Street, Doña Elvira Sq, Rodrigo Caro Street, De la Alianza Sq, Joaquín Romero Murube Street up to Triunfo Sq. Right there you gonna fall in love with Seville as you will have the Cathedral, Reales Alcazares (an ancient palace and fortress built by the Muslims) and Archivo de Indias (a library where all the documents and books related to the Spanish Empire trading monopoly during XV, XVI & XVII centuries are kept). This walk would take an hour and a half to be completed on a gentle and relaxed pace
